centos7虚拟机无法启动
时间: 2023-09-10 10:02:12 浏览: 286
CentOS 7虚拟机无法启动可能是由于多种原因导致的。以下是一些常见的情况和可能的解决方案:
1. 虚拟机配置错误:检查虚拟机配置是否正确,包括内存、CPU、硬盘空间等。确保为虚拟机分配了足够的资源。如果配置不正确,可以通过编辑虚拟机设置来调整。
2. 虚拟机文件损坏:检查虚拟机文件是否完好,特别是虚拟硬盘文件。如果文件损坏,可以尝试使用备份文件、修复工具或重新创建虚拟机。
3. 虚拟化软件问题:如果使用的是VMware Workstation或VirtualBox等虚拟化软件,可能是软件本身的问题。确保虚拟化软件是最新版本,并尝试重新安装或升级软件。
4. 操作系统问题:检查主机操作系统是否有任何更新、补丁或驱动程序问题,这可能会影响虚拟机的启动。确保主机操作系统和虚拟机操作系统的兼容性。
5. 硬件问题:虚拟机无法启动可能与主机上的硬件故障有关。检查主机的硬件设备是否正常工作,尤其是CPU、内存和硬盘。
6. 日志文件:查看虚拟机的日志文件,以获取更多的信息和错误消息。日志文件通常位于虚拟化软件的安装目录或虚拟机配置文件所在位置。
如果以上解决方案都无法解决问题,建议向相关的技术支持或论坛寻求帮助。提供更详细的信息,如错误消息、日志文件内容等,有助于他人更准确地诊断和解决问题。
相关问题
Centos7 虚拟机
### CentOS 7 虚拟机安装配置使用教程
#### 创建虚拟机基础配置
为了创建CentOS 7的虚拟环境,可以选择诸如VMware这样的桌面型hypervisor工具[^2]。启动VMware并选择新建虚拟机,在向导中指定稍后会用于安装系统的ISO镜像文件位置。
#### 配置硬件资源分配
在创建过程中合理规划CPU核心数、内存大小以及硬盘空间对于确保系统性能至关重要。根据实际需求调整这些参数,通常建议至少分配2GB以上的RAM给新建立的Guest OS以便流畅运行[^1]。
#### 开始操作系统安装过程
当一切准备就绪之后就可以正式开启安装流程了。加载好光盘映像后重启机器,按照屏幕提示依次完成语言选择、时区设定等基本选项配置;特别注意在网络设备命名方面如果有特殊要求可以在此阶段做出相应更改[^3]。
```bash
# 如果需要自定义网络接口名称可编辑如下文件
vi /etc/default/grub
# 添加 net.ifnames=0 biosdevname=0 到GRUB_CMDLINE_LINUX行内保存退出后再更新grub配置
grub2-mkconfig -o /boot/efi/EFI/centos/grub.cfg
```
#### 完成初始化设置
首次登录成功后还需进一步优化软件源列表以加速后续包管理器的操作效率,并考虑关闭SELinux增强安全性的同时简化权限控制逻辑:
```bash
# 修改yum仓库地址为中国科技大学镜像站提高下载速度
sed -i 's|^mirrorlist|#mirrorlist|g' /etc/yum.repos.d/CentOS-*.repo
sed -i 's|^#baseurl=http://mirror.centos.org|baseurl=https://mirrors.ustc.edu.cn|g' /etc/yum.repos.d/CentOS-*.repo
# 设置 SELinux 成为 permissive 模式而非 enforcing模式
setenforce 0
sed -i 's/^SELINUX=enforcing$/SELINUX=permissive/' /etc/selinux/config
```
centos7虚拟机
CentOS 7 是一种常用的 Linux 操作系统,您可以在虚拟机中安装和运行它。以下是如何在虚拟机上安装 CentOS 7 的简要步骤:
1. 首先,您需要选择一个虚拟化软件,比如 VirtualBox 或 VMware Workstation。您可以根据您的需求和偏好选择其中之一。
2. 下载 CentOS 7 的 ISO 镜像文件。您可以从 CentOS 官方网站(https://www.centos.org/)上获取最新版本的 ISO 镜像。
3. 打开虚拟化软件,并创建一个新的虚拟机。在创建过程中,选择 "Linux" 作为操作系统类型,并选择 "CentOS 64-bit"(如果您下载的是 64 位版本的镜像)作为版本。
4. 分配适当的内存和硬盘空间给虚拟机。建议至少分配 2GB 的内存和 20GB 的硬盘空间。
5. 在虚拟机创建完成后,选择刚刚下载的 CentOS 7 ISO 镜像文件作为虚拟光驱中的安装介质。
6. 启动虚拟机并按照屏幕上的指示进行安装。您可能需要选择语言、键盘布局等选项,并设置根密码。
7. 完成安装后,重启虚拟机并登录到 CentOS 7。
这是一个基本的安装过程,具体步骤可能因虚拟化软件的不同而有所差异。如果您需要更详细的安装指南,可以参考虚拟化软件的官方文档或在互联网上搜索相关教程。
阅读全文